titleOfInvention System for Delivering an Active Substance for Sustained Release
abstract A system for delivering an active substance has sustained release of the active substance in the intestinal tract. This delivery system is especially useful for an active substance such as a .beta.-lactam antibiotic which preferably has minimal exposure to the ac-idic environment of the stomach. Particles comprise an active ingredient disposed in a core which has at least one coating of a prolamine and one coating of an enteric compound thereon. The particles may be very small and suspended in a liquid medium.
